The MSBA's Labor & Employment Law Section Presents
"An Update on Religious Discrimination Claims from the Prospective of Both Plaintiffs and Defendants"
Please join the MSBA Labor & Employment Law Section and your fellow investigators for breakfast and a timely seminar. Bruce J. Douglas and David E. Schlesinger will discuss religious discrimination claims from the prospective of both plaintiffs and defendants. They will focus in particular on religious accommodation claims involving Muslim workers’ requests for time to pray at work. This program is aimed at helping investigators, plaintiff and defense counsel better assist clients in religious discrimination matters.
